Works in relief Monday
PLos Angeles Dodgers
May 21, 2024
Hernandez gave up two earned runs on two hits over an inning of relief in Monday's 6-4 win over the Diamondbacks.
ANALYSIS
After being called up from Triple-A Oklahoma City on Wednesday, Hernandez ended up starting in the Dodgers' series finale in San Francisco, covering six innings while giving up three earned runs in a losing effort. With an off day coming up Thursday, the Dodgers weren't in need of an additional starter this week, so Hernandez shifted to the bullpen. He'll likely work mostly in lower-leverage spots while he remains up with the Dodgers.

To be starter?
PNew York Mets
March 26, 2023
Hernandez projects to slot into the Mets' arsenal of starters as opposed to the actively shuffling bullpen, shares Anthony DiComo of MLB.com
ANALYSIS
Hernandez is coming off an ugly 2022 season, logging a 5.98 ERA as a starter and a 7.47 ERA out of the bullpen. His 4.81 expected ERA was more palatable, but he relinquished 19 home runs as well. Mets manager Buck Showalter sees him as a starter, but he'll need to prove some reliability.

Hernandez spent the first two months in the Marlins rotation. He was sporting a 6.75 ERA and 1.44 WHIP when he was demoted to Triple-A Jacksonville in early June. Hernandez was recalled in early July to pitch as a reliever. He had another stint with the Jumbo Shrimp in August but finished the campaign in the Marlins bullpen. Homers have always been an issue for the righty, but last season was extreme with 19 surrendered in only 62.1 frames. Combined with fewer strikeouts and more walks and it's understandable why Hernandez finished with a 6.35 ERA, the eighth worst among hurlers collecting at least 50 innings. The Mets must still see something they like since they traded for Hernandez in the offseason to serve as a depth piece. Citi Field, like Marlins Stadium, is a good place to pitch, but Hernandez needs to show he can keep the ball in the yard before getting an invite to the fantasy party.
Hernandez may not not have the upside that others on the Miami staff do, but what he lacks in stuff he makes up for in command when he can stay healthy. Hernandez was progressing nicely in 2020 before injuries ended his season and the same thing happened last year with both a biceps injury as well as a severe quad strain limiting him to 51.2 innings. He has never been able to stay on the mound for any length of time, and one wonders if his future is in the bullpen given the massive splits in his history. Hernandez has a 20.8 K-BB% with a 1.09 WHIP against righties but a 9.4 K-BB% and a 1.50 WHIP against lefties for his career. The lack of an effective changeup is mostly to blame and he cannot turn a lineup over a third time without one. He was attempting to use his changeup more last year, doubling its usage from 2020 before his injury.
Considering Hernandez only started six games, averaging about 4.1 frames per outing, the best way to describe his numbers is "encouraging." Hernandez recorded a 32.1 K% and 4.7 BB%. The resulting 27.4 K-BB% would have been fourth best if he worked enough innings to qualify. The uptick in strikeout rate was supported by more swinging strikes. Hernandez's season was cut short by a sore right lat, although he's on target to be ready in the spring. He continued to struggle with homers, surrendering five for a bloated 1.75 HR/9. Considering Marlins Park is one of the best pitching venues in the league, it's no surprise Hernandez fared better at home. He's earmarked for a spot in the Miami rotation and thus is an ideal candidate to use as a streamer for home games, or maybe more if last year's improvements prove genuine.
Hernandez has pitched to a 5.11 ERA and 1.33 WHIP in nearly 150 innings at the major-league level. Last season saw some positive steps -- his 16.7 K-BB% should not be overlooked -- though the stuff that happened in between the strikeouts and walks is tough to overlook. He allowed 20 home runs in 82.1 innings of work, and lefties teed off on him to the tune of a .260/.341/.568 line last season. Nine of his 20 homers were hit by righties, but he held them to a .226/.296/.446 line overall. His flyball tendencies are better suited in Miami (4.26 ERA) than on the road (5.92 ERA). The issue with Hernandez is command of his pitches; when he misses, the batters do not. When he commands his stuff well, he can be successful. Right now home starts with righty-heavy lineups are his sweet spot.
